хо́лить — meaning in English

kholit

Russian → English · translate English → Russian instead

English meaning

  • cherish verb To care for someone or something deeply and protect it tenderly.
  • foster verb To raise or care for a child who is not biologically one's own.

Senses

хо́лить is used for these senses in English:

  • cherish To treat with affection, care, and tenderness; to nurture or protect with care.
  • foster (transitive) To nurture or bring up offspring, or to provide similar parental care to an unrelated child.
  • foster (transitive) To nurse or cherish something.

cherish — full definition

  1. verb To care for someone or something deeply and protect it tenderly.
  2. verb To hold an idea, memory, or hope dear.

foster — full definition

  1. verb To raise or care for a child who is not biologically one's own.
  2. verb To help something grow or develop, such as a skill, relationship, or idea.
  3. adj Describing a family relationship based on care rather than blood, as in foster parent or foster child.
